West Virginia Census Data

A demographic, economic, and housing profile of West Virginia, built from the U.S. Census Bureau's 2024 American Community Survey Public Use Microdata Sample. West Virginia is home to 1,769,979 people across 12 PUMAs, with a median household income of $60,915 and a median age of 42.2.

West Virginia at a glance, vs. the U.S.

Every figure below is a weighted estimate from the 2024 ACS PUMS. The U.S. column is the population-weighted national average for comparison.

EconomicWest VirginiaU.S.
Median household income$60,915$83,310
Mean wage (workers)$53,174$66,223
Poverty rate16.1%12.1%
Unemployment rate4.4%4.6%
EducationWest VirginiaU.S.
Bachelor's degree or higher24.7%36.9%
HealthWest VirginiaU.S.
Uninsured6.4%8.4%
Private insurance63.3%66.7%
Public insurance46.3%37.0%
With a disability20.4%14.1%
CommuteWest VirginiaU.S.
Mean commute time27 min27 min
Drove to work86.5%78.5%
Public transit to work0.6%3.7%
Worked from home8.9%13.3%
HousingWest VirginiaU.S.
Median home value$170,000$390,221
Median gross rent$889$1,507
Rent as % of income28.0%30.6%
Homeownership rate75.6%65.1%
Median bedrooms32.9
Median rooms65.6
Median year built19701976
Vehicles per household1.81.8
No vehicle8.2%8.5%
Single-family detached72.8%62.1%
Broadband internet92.4%95.0%
DemographicsWest VirginiaU.S.
Population1,769,979340,110,990
Average age42.239.8
Married (15+)49.7%47.9%
Hispanic or Latino2.3%20.0%
Black3.2%11.7%
Asian0.7%6.2%

A PUMA (Public Use Microdata Area) is a Census geography of roughly 100,000+ people — the finest level at which PUMS microdata is released. Below are every PUMA in West Virginia, ranked by population.

Where does this West Virginia data come from?+

These figures are derived from the U.S. Census Bureau's 2024 ACS Public Use Microdata Sample (PUMS) — a de-identified, statistically weighted sample of individual records. PUMSdata is an independent product and is not affiliated with the Census Bureau.
